From 7f406414b1d0bc146c48b4951da75e91f3b9759a Mon Sep 17 00:00:00 2001 From: gazebo Date: Wed, 24 Apr 2019 20:13:17 +0800 Subject: [PATCH] =?UTF-8?q?-=20=E4=BA=AC=E4=B8=9C=E5=9B=9E=E8=B0=83?= =?UTF-8?q?=EF=BC=8C=E9=9D=9E=E7=94=9F=E4=BA=A7=E7=8E=AF=E5=A2=83=E4=B8=80?= =?UTF-8?q?=E5=AE=9A=E8=BF=94=E5=9B=9E=E6=88=90=E5=8A=9F?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- controllers/jd_callback.go | 3 +++ globals/globals.go | 4 ++++ 2 files changed, 7 insertions(+) diff --git a/controllers/jd_callback.go b/controllers/jd_callback.go index 3552b254a..1c53dae93 100644 --- a/controllers/jd_callback.go +++ b/controllers/jd_callback.go @@ -145,6 +145,9 @@ func (c *DjswController) StoreCrud() { } func (c *DjswController) transferResponse(inCallbackResponse *jdapi.CallbackResponse) (outCallbackResponse *jdapi.CallbackResponse) { + if globals.IsCallbackAlwaysReturnSuccess() { + return jdapi.SuccessResponse + } if inCallbackResponse == nil { return jdapi.SuccessResponse } diff --git a/globals/globals.go b/globals/globals.go index 54771717c..25ba12984 100644 --- a/globals/globals.go +++ b/globals/globals.go @@ -67,3 +67,7 @@ func Init() { WeimobCallbackURL = beego.AppConfig.DefaultString("weimobCallbackURL", "") WeimobStateSecret = beego.AppConfig.DefaultString("weimobStateSecret", "") } + +func IsCallbackAlwaysReturnSuccess() bool { + return beego.BConfig.RunMode == "beta" +}